The School of Nursing has developed learning opportunities designed to give individuals with a baccalaureate degree in another academic discipline the theoretical and applied skills necessary for the professional practice of nursing.
The Entry Level MSN program is a full-time (most are day classes), seven-semester graduate program. Graduates of this program will be awarded a Master of Science in Nursing degree, and will be eligible to take the examination for licensure as a registered nurse.
The program is accredited by the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) and approved by the Minnesota Board of Nursing. The program is endorsed by the American Holistic Nursing Certification Corporation.
School of Nursing Mission
The mission of the School of Nursing is to prepare registered nurses in order to advance professional nursing and enhance the health of underserved and diverse populations. The School of Nursing is committed to academic excellence, collaborative community involvement, and promotion of faculty scholarly activities.
